Understanding Organic SEO
SEO focuses on improving website visibility through content, keywords, and technical optimization.
Benefits include:
- Long-term traffic growth
- Higher credibility
- Lower cost over time
Understanding Paid Advertising
Paid advertising delivers instant visibility through platforms like Google Ads and Meta Ads.
Benefits include:
- Immediate traffic
- Precise targeting
- Scalable campaigns
Key Differences at a Glance
| Aspect | SEO | Paid Advertising |
| Results Speed | Slow but lasting | Instant |
| Cost | Long-term investment | Pay per click |
| Trust | High credibility | Ad-dependent |
